Understanding Scadapack Programming Software

Scadapack programming software is a specialized tool designed primarily for

programming SCADAPack RTUs, which are widely used in water and wastewater

management, oil and gas pipelines, and other critical infrastructure sectors. The software

allows users to develop control strategies using a graphical interface or ladder logic,

simplifying the process of automation programming.

What makes this tool particularly appealing is its focus on reliability and real-time control.

SCADAPack RTUs are often deployed in remote or harsh environments where consistent

performance is vital. The programming software ensures that the control logic is

optimized for such scenarios, handling data acquisition, control commands, and

communication protocols effectively.

Key Features of Scadapack Programming Software

**User-Friendly Interface:** The software features an intuitive graphical user

interface that allows engineers to create control programs without extensive coding

knowledge. Drag-and-drop functionality and pre-built blocks expedite the

programming process.

**Ladder Logic Programming:** For those accustomed to traditional PLC

programming, ladder logic support offers familiarity and ease of transitioning

between platforms.

**Real-Time Monitoring and Debugging:** Users can monitor the RTU’s operations in

real-time, troubleshoot issues, and modify logic on the fly, ensuring minimal

downtime.

**Communication Protocol Support:** The software supports various protocols like

Modbus, DNP3, and IEC 60870-5-101/104, enabling seamless integration with

SCADA systems and other devices.

**Simulation Capabilities:** Before deployment, the control logic can be simulated

and tested within the software, reducing the risk of field errors.

Question

Answer

What is SCADAPack

programming software?

SCADAPack programming software is a specialized tool

used for configuring, programming, and managing

Schneider Electric's SCADAPack RTUs (Remote Terminal

Units) for industrial automation and control systems.

Which programming

languages are supported by

SCADAPack programming

software?

SCADAPack programming software primarily supports

programming using IEC 61131-3 languages such as

Ladder Diagram (LD), Function Block Diagram (FBD),

and Structured Text (ST).

Is SCADAPack programming

software compatible with

Windows operating systems?

Yes, SCADAPack programming software is designed to

run on Windows operating systems, including Windows

10 and Windows 7, providing a user-friendly interface

for RTU programming and configuration.

Can SCADAPack

programming software be

used for remote device

programming?

Yes, SCADAPack programming software supports remote

programming and configuration of SCADAPack RTUs via

serial, Ethernet, or modem connections, enabling

efficient field device management.

What are the key features of

SCADAPack programming

software?

Key features include graphical programming

environment, real-time monitoring and debugging,

support for IEC 61131-3 languages, communication

protocol configuration, and easy firmware updates for

SCADAPack RTUs.

How do I connect SCADAPack

programming software to an

RTU?

You can connect SCADAPack programming software to

an RTU using serial cables (RS-232/RS-485), Ethernet

connections, or modem links, depending on the specific

RTU model and communication setup.

Core Features and Capabilities

At its core, scadapack programming software supports various programming languages

and methodologies that align with IEC 61131-3 standards, including:

Function Block Diagram (FBD)

1.

Ladder Logic (LD)

2.

Structured Text (ST)

3.

This versatility allows programmers to select the language best suited to their application

or personal expertise. The software includes a debugging environment, simulation tools,

and a user-friendly graphical interface that simplifies the development process.

Another notable feature is the comprehensive support for SCADA communication

protocols. Scadapack programming software facilitates the configuration of Modbus RTU,

DNP3, and other industry-standard protocols, which are essential for real-time data

exchange between RTUs and central control systems.

Comparative Analysis with Other Automation Programming Tools

While there is a broad spectrum of programming software available for industrial

automation, scadapack programming software distinguishes itself through its specificity

and integration with SCADAPACK RTUs. When compared to more general-purpose

automation platforms such as Siemens TIA Portal or Rockwell Automation’s Studio 5000,

the scadapack environment offers targeted functionality but may lack the extensive

hardware compatibility those platforms provide.

In terms of user experience, some professionals note that the scadapack programming

software interface may feel less modern or intuitive compared to newer IDEs. However, its

focus on stability and adherence to SCADAPACK system requirements makes it a reliable

choice for mission-critical deployments.

Challenges and Limitations

Despite its strengths, scadapack programming software is not without its drawbacks.

Users occasionally report a steeper learning curve for those unfamiliar with SCADAPACK

architecture or the software’s interface design. Additionally, compared to more

comprehensive automation suites, it offers limited support for third-party hardware, which

can constrain flexibility in diverse system environments.

Updates and community support, while consistent, may not be as expansive as those for

more widely adopted platforms, potentially impacting long-term scalability and access to

advanced features.

Practical Applications and Industry Use Cases

Scadapack programming software finds its greatest utility in sectors where remote

monitoring and control are paramount. Utilities managing electrical grids often deploy

SCADAPACK RTUs programmed through this software to automate load balancing and

fault detection. Similarly, in oil and gas pipeline management, the software enables

condition monitoring and emergency shutdown procedures to be programmed, enhancing

operational safety.

Water treatment facilities benefit from using scadapack programming software to control

pumps, valves, and chemical dosing systems remotely, ensuring compliance with

environmental regulations and optimizing resource consumption.
